Output 39187d4c4590ee7381547fedee16d5c028037665fb629a46ea911bef96611ea4:0

value
1261262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d88ea0c1d5e5a2b7d84f8cf5547824655e13ea OP_EQUAL
address
379TDWruoJVkGgn8621k3KHtRCsbMYykv8
transaction
39187d4c4590ee7381547fedee16d5c028037665fb629a46ea911bef96611ea4
confirmations
312366
spent
true